About Yala Stablecoin

YU (Yala Stablecoin) is a digital currency designed to provide stability and ease of use in everyday transactions, aiming to bridge the gap between traditional finance and the cryptocurrency ecosystem. Utilizing a robust collateralization strategy, YU maintains its peg to a stable asset, ensuring minimal volatility. The primary target audience includes individuals and businesses seeking a reliable medium of exchange within the crypto space. Traders and investors track YU for its potential to serve as a dependable store of value and a means of transaction in the rapidly evolving digital economy.
